Inspection Reports Summary
An editor-reviewed summary of the themes and findings across this facility's recent inspection reports.
The most recent inspection on February 12, 2025, was a complaint investigation that found no deficiencies. Earlier inspections showed mostly no deficiencies, with one exception in October 2024 when the facility was cited for failing to report an alleged abuse incident within the required timeframe. That deficiency was corrected upon a revisit, and no enforcement actions or fines were listed in the available reports. Complaint investigations were generally unsubstantiated except for the delayed reporting issue, which was addressed promptly. The inspection history suggests the facility has maintained compliance with regulatory requirements, with a minor issue resolved and no clear pattern of recurring deficiencies.

Frequently Asked Questions about Arbor House of Norman
Is Arbor House of Norman in a walkable area?
Arbor House of Norman has a walk score of 16. Car-dependent. Most errands require a car, with limited nearby walkable options.
What is the license number of Arbor House of Norman?
According to OK state health department records, Arbor House of Norman's license number is AL1405.
What is the occupancy rate at Arbor House of Norman?
Arbor House of Norman's occupancy is 73%.
Who is the administrator of Arbor House of Norman?
Judy Kirkland is the administrator of Arbor House of Norman.
How many beds does Arbor House of Norman have?
Arbor House of Norman has 62 beds.
